An accidental drowning... or was it? Ed Brighton has sacrificed his marriage and just about everything else to buy and run a small-town newspaper. After months where the news highlights are fender-benders and service club meetings, the tragic death is front page stuff... but Ed suspects there is more to the story than the cops are willing to believe. He is joined in his investigation by a coffee buddy he suspects of being gay, and the woman he has secretly longed for... well, lusted after... for months. Ed, Kate and Chester encounter a full roster of oddball residents, many of them adding to the mystery. "The author's candid observations and playful writing — and yes, stop the press, there's some sex — hold your attention until the action heats up and the story races to a satisfying ending." - Jon Fear, Waterloo Region Record. "Recommended if you've been enjoying Terry Fallis, or wish someone would make you a 'just the fun bits' edit of some Robertson Davies." - Erin Bardua, on Goodreads
